云计算系统的安全是确保数据和应用程序在云环境中可靠、高效运行的关键。为了构建坚固的防护屏障,需要采取一系列措施来保护云计算系统免受各种威胁。以下是一些关键步骤和策略:
1. 身份验证与访问控制:确保只有经过授权的用户才能访问云计算资源,包括用户账户、密钥和其他敏感信息。这可以通过多因素认证、角色基础访问控制(RBAC)和最小权限原则来实现。
2. 加密:对数据传输和存储进行加密,以防止未授权访问和数据泄露。使用强加密算法(如AES-256)和行业标准(如TLS/SSL)来保护数据。
3. 数据备份与恢复:定期备份数据,以便在发生故障时能够迅速恢复。同时,实施灾难恢复计划以确保在发生严重故障时可以快速恢复正常运营。
4. 网络隔离:通过虚拟私人网络(VPN)、防火墙和子网划分将云计算环境与其他网络隔离,以防止未经授权的访问和外部攻击。
5. 安全配置管理:确保所有云平台和服务都遵循最佳实践和安全标准。定期更新和打补丁,以修复已知的安全漏洞。
6. 监控与日志记录:监控系统性能和安全事件,以便及时发现和响应潜在的安全威胁。记录关键操作和事件,以便在出现问题时进行调查和分析。
7. 安全意识培训:为云服务提供商、开发人员、运维人员和最终用户提供安全培训,提高他们对潜在威胁的认识和防范能力。
8. 合规性与法规遵守:确保云计算系统符合相关法规要求,如GDPR、HIPAA等。这可能需要投资于合规性解决方案,如加密、访问控制和审计日志。
9. 第三方服务和供应商审查:在选择第三方服务和供应商时,要进行严格的审查和评估,以确保他们的安全实践和声誉良好。
10. 应急响应计划:制定并测试应急响应计划,以便在发生安全事件时迅速采取行动。这包括确定关键人员、准备应急设备和工具,以及确保通信渠道畅通。
通过实施这些策略,云计算系统可以构建一个坚固的防护屏障,降低安全风险,并确保数据和应用程序的可靠性和安全性。